Volkswagen Korea will begin customer deliveries of the Coupe-style pure electric SUV "ID.5" in May, following the best-selling electric vehicle ID.4.
The ID.4, Volkswagen Korea's first electric vehicle, has been well-received since its domestic launch in 2022, recording the highest sales of European brand electric vehicles in the Korean market last year and achieving first place in European brand electric vehicle sales in the first quarter of this year.
"ID.5" is the second pure electric model from Volkswagen Korea, following the best-selling pure electric SUV, ID.4, which recorded the highest sales of a single European electric vehicle model in the first quarter of this year. The official selling price is 60.99 million won (after tax benefits, including value-added tax), with a government subsidy of 2.15 million won allocated. In addition, Volkswagen Korea will provide additional special purchase subsidies of about 2 million won to customers receiving the ID.5 delivery. (Ends when exhausted)
Accordingly, the ID.5, with an official selling price of 60.99 million won, can be purchased for around 45 million won when applying all government subsidies, local subsidies, special purchase subsidies, and Volkswagen purchase benefits. (*Based on Seoul; varies by local government)
With the official delivery of the ID.5 starting in May and the domestic arrival and delivery of the best-selling electric vehicle ID.4 scheduled for the end of next month, Volkswagen Korea plans to solidify its leadership in imported electric vehicles this year with the dual strategy of the ID.4 and ID.5.
The ID.5 boasts an excellent level of completion, equipped with proven performance and outstanding efficiency characteristic of Volkswagen's electric SUVs, a beautiful coupe-style design, and advanced safety and convenience specifications.
The stylish appeal unique to the ID.5 is evident throughout its exterior. The elegant curve that extends from the front of the body to the back and the short front overhang emphasize the sporty coupe style. In particular, the streamlined coupe roof line and rear spoiler maximize aerodynamic performance, achieving an impressive low coefficient of drag (Cd) of 0.26.
The front bumper features a 3D honeycomb design, while the winglet design that wraps around the front enhances its striking image. The harmony between the panoramic glass roof and black roof, along with the door panels finished in body color, emphasizes the urban appeal unique to the ID.5.
Thanks to the innovative design of Volkswagen's electric vehicle-specific MEB platform, space utilization is also improved. With a wheelbase of 2,765mm, it offers ample headroom and legroom for enhanced livability, while the trunk capacity reaches 549 liters and expands to 1,561 liters when the second-row seats are folded, providing generous cargo space for recreational activities or everyday trunk usage.
The ID.5 is equipped with Volkswagen's latest powerful and efficient drive system. It features a strong permanent magnet rotor, an improved stator, and a new inverter that provides high-output current, achieving a maximum output of 286 horsepower (PS) and maximum torque of 55.6 kg.m, with a powerful performance that acc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in just 6.7 seconds.
Thanks to its powerful yet efficient drive system and aerodynamic design, the ID.5 boasts a long driving range and high energy efficiency. The range on a single charge is a combined 434 km (460 km in the city / 402 km on the highway), with the government-certified energy consumption efficiency at a combined 5.0 km/kWh (5.3 km/kWh in the city / 4.6 km/kWh on the highway).
Equipped with a high-efficiency high-voltage battery with a capacity of 82.836 kWh, it supports fast charging of up to 175 kW. Using fast charging, it is possible to charge the battery from 10% to 80% in about 28 minutes. Additionally, a "battery heater" feature is applied to optimize the charging speed regardless of the surrounding environment and temperature.
The interior features an intuitive and convenient driver-friendly configuration.
The centrally located "12.9-inch Discover Max" infotainment system provides intuitive operation and personalization as well as fast response to commands. The "illuminated touch slider" located at the bottom of the display allows convenient operation of infotainment functions even at night. The advanced voice assistant "IDA," capable of naturally controlling the vehicle's media, climate, and driving settings by voice as if conversing with a person, along with the "wireless app connect" feature allowing Apple CarPlay and Android Auto functionalities without cable connections, enhance convenience.
Volkswagen's advanced safety features are generously equipped. The advanced driving assistance feature "IQ. Drive" helps maintain speed and lane while considering the distance from the vehicle in front across all driving speed ranges, including features like "Travel Assist", "Adaptive Cruise Control", "Lane Assist", "Side Assist", and "Rear Traffic Alert System", as well as "Front Assist," which stops driving and alerts the driver in emergencies when there is no response for a certain period of time. The intelligent interactive lighting system "IQ. Light: LED Matrix Headlamps" is also equipped to offer optimal visibility in dark conditions.
The ID.5 is equipped with preferred specifications for Korean customers, including front seats with memory, massage, and heating functions; a "3-Zone Climatronic Automatic Air Conditioning" system; an "Electric Power Trunk" with easy open & close; a "Panoramic Glass Roof"; and "30-Color Ambient Light".
